Ghana’s shaman predicts challenges for Cape Verde

1 July 2026
in Sports
Share on FacebookShare on Twitter



The Ghanaian shaman Nana Kwaku Bonsam has stirred controversy with a bold prediction regarding the upcoming World Cup match between Argentina and Cape Verde. Bonsam claims that Cape Verde will defeat the Argentine national team, referred to as La Scaloneta, in what he suggests could be the most significant upset in World Cup history. His reputation as a mystic has grown, particularly after he previously asserted that he placed a “curse” on England’s Harry Kane, which was followed by the player’s scoring struggles. Despite the lack of scientific support for such predictions, his statements have gained traction on social media, prompting Argentine fans to respond with rituals aimed at countering any negative effects. Meanwhile, Cape Verde is embracing the mystique surrounding the prediction as they prepare for the match, which could have far-reaching implications for the tournament.

Why It Matters

Nana Kwaku Bonsam’s predictions reflect the cultural intersection of sports and superstition, particularly in football where folklore can influence fan behavior and team morale. Historically, the World Cup has been a stage for unexpected outcomes, with numerous underdog teams achieving surprising victories. The influence of public sentiment and belief in omens or curses can affect players’ performances and fan engagement, as seen in the actions of Argentine supporters. Cape Verde’s potential success against Argentina would not only be a historic upset but could also shift perceptions of African teams in global football dynamics.
